Big fireplaces can be found in a range of styles, each using its own appeal and character. Below are some popular style styles:
1. Standard Fireplaces
Conventional big fireplaces typically feature traditional products like brick or stone. They frequently consist of in-depth moldings and wood mantels, improving the vintage appeal.
2. Contemporary Fireplaces
Concentrating on minimalism, modern large fireplaces may utilize glass, metal, or concrete. They typically have streamlined lines and can be constructed into walls as an architectural function.
3. Rustic Fireplaces
Rustic large fireplaces commemorate natural textures, frequently using recovered wood and fieldstone. These fireplaces develop a warm, welcoming atmosphere similar to countryside retreats.
4. Modern Farmhouse Fireplaces
Combining functionality with style, Contemporary Fireplaces farmhouse big fireplaces typically feature shiplap surrounds and whitewashed surfaces, striking a balance in between beauty and heat.
5. Outdoor Fireplaces
Large outdoor fireplaces extend the home, supplying heat and ambiance for outdoor gatherings. These can be built from stone, brick, and even metal.

Installing a big fireplace is a considerable investment and needs careful preparation. House owners ought to think about:
Location: Find a central area to maximize the fireplace's effect.Ventilation: Ensure appropriate chimney or venting to promote efficient air flow and security.Structure Codes: Adhere to local building codes and regulations for fireplace setup.Upkeep Tips
Maintaining a big fireplace is vital for both safety and longevity. Here are some ideas:
Regular Cleaning: Clean the fireplace and chimney at least once a year to avoid soot accumulation and chimney fires.Check for Damage: Inspect for any cracks in the masonry or damage to the flue.Wood Storage: If using a wood-burning fireplace, store firewood far from the house to prevent pests.Usage Quality Wood: Burn experienced wood for an efficient fire and less smoke.Examine the Damper: Ensure the damper opens and closes correctly to maintain airflow.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What is the very best size for a large fireplace?
The size of a large fireplace must match the measurements of the space. It needs to be proportionate to the space to create a balanced appearance.
2. Is it more economical to have a wood-burning or gas fireplace?
Wood-burning fireplaces typically have lower setup costs, however gas fireplaces may be more economical in the long run due to lower maintenance and fuel expenses.
3. How can I make my big fireplace more energy-efficient?
Think about including glass doors, acquiring a fireplace insert, or making use of blowers for much better heat circulation.
4. Do large fireplaces need special authorizations for installation?
Many jurisdictions need authorizations for fireplace setup due to safety guidelines. Always consult regional authorities before proceeding.
5. Can I set up a big fireplace myself?
While DIY installation is possible, it is recommended to seek advice from professionals to guarantee safety and compliance with structure codes.
